Cowes

Cowes is a town on the west side of the estuary of the River Medina on the Isle of Wight. It is known for Cowes Week, an annual regatta.

The town of Cowes is situated on the west bank of the River Medina, facing the smaller town of East Cowes on the east bank. The two towns are connected by a chain ferry known as the Floating Bridge.

Cowes Week is a yachting festival that takes place annually in early August. It was first held in 1826 and is now one of the largest sailing events in the world, with around 8,500 boats taking part.

Cowes is also home to The Classic Boat Museum, which houses a collection of over 100 historic boats.
